Common Name The Split Nine Fold Habenaria
Flower Size 1" [2.5 cm]
Found in southern Mexico, Guatemala, Belize, Honduras, Nicaragua and Costa Rica in pine oak forests on steep slopes at elevations of 1200 to 1400 meters as a medium sized, warm growing terrestrial with a leafy, angled stem enveloped completely by leaf bearing sheaths and carrying patent, lanceolate, acute, basally clasping leaves that blooms in the later summer on an erect, terminal, racemose, few to many flowered inflorescence with green, lanceolate, acuminate floral bracts.
Synonyms Habenaria dipleura Schltr. 1918; Habenaria quinquefila Schltr. 1918
